NDSL 8C (Paul Mason) : Last
week's under 8G is now under 8C and they played their
first competitive match in this division against the
leaders, Cloughertown. This was a fantastic match with
end to end play. Cloughertown opened the scoring after
10 minutes and Celtic replied almost immediately with a
fine effort from Luke Penrose. Celtic conceded a second
just before half time and when they conceded third after
the break it looked ominous, but they dominated the
last 10 minutes and goals from Mykola Babiy and Geremi
Mputu levelled it at 3:3.
Celtic had a
host of chances in the final minutes but had to settle
for the draw which was a fantastic first match effort in
this league. 3:3

NDSL 10D (M Farrell) : Celtic were left
scratching their heads after this defeat at home to Malahide Utd. Murungu struck twice for Celtic, but
they also twice hit the woodwork, which on another day
would have found the back of the net. Celtic's
defensive qualities were on show too, and Jamie Farrell
put in a man of the match performance with his crucial
tackles at critical times. Though defeated, Celtic
put in a great team performance which augurs well for
the future. 2-4

14Major (D Bradshaw) : A rip-roaring contest
in Porterstown. Celtic's rivals for many years,
Leicester, got off to a flyer with 2 goals, the
second from a penalty. Eoin Geraghty scored their
first from a beautifully flighted cross from Peter Durrad.
Their second came from a penalty despatched with aplomb
by Owen Norton, after Ruadhan Magee was taken down in
the box. Celtic fought back with
every sinew but it fell short, despite a smashing strike
from Kevin Flanagan 10 mins from time. Celtic
launched attack after attack, with Robbie McGivern
playing splendidly. Celtic did
not have it all their own way in the second half, and
they had the silky skills of Lucas Borsquet to contend
with to prevent them falling further behind. 1-2.
